WebWell, the two letters “ic” stands for InterContainer, and “81” means that Austrian Federal Railways certified the Hapag-Lloyd container is allowed to be used for rail transport. That's it. The question is what if the two digits is not "81". The answer: then another organization certifies the container bearing the code. Such charges are usually for agents' … WebApr 21, 2024 · A Letter of Credit is a formal, binding legal agreement between an importer and foreign seller. A Letter of Credit is one of the most secure methods of payment between the seller and the buyer. It can balance the risk for both the seller and buyer. The seller gets paid automatically once they meet all the terms of the Letter of Credit.
